I didn’t even need to look at the album’s website to know that the lyrics to this song were written by kaztora. They have such a… distinct lyrical style. If azuki’s lyrics are a heartening, full-course meal, kaztora’s lyrics are red hot chilies. They’re just so spicy.
Anyway, 大地獄 (daijigoku) is contrasted with plain old 地獄 (jigoku, Hell). ‘Grand Hell’ sounds a bit weird, so I went a bit further and used Avīci, which is apparently the lowest level of Hell.
